開啟SXC文件

介紹

您是否希望使用 .NET 與 SXC 檔案進行互動?如果是這樣,那麼您來對地方了!在本教學中,我們將探討如何使用 Aspose.Cells for .NET 開啟和讀取 SXC (StarOffice Calc) 檔案。無論您是開發 .NET 應用程式的開發人員還是只是對處理電子表格檔案感到好奇,本指南都將引導您完成必要的步驟,使整個過程順利而簡單。 所以,拿起你的編碼帽子,讓我們深入了解使用 Aspose.Cells 處理 SXC 檔案的世界!

先決條件

在我們開始之前,您需要做一些事情來確保您擁有正確的工具和知識:

  1. .NET Framework:對 .NET 架構和 C# 程式語言有基本的了解。
  2. Aspose.Cells 安裝:您需要下載並安裝 Aspose.Cells for .NET 函式庫。你可以輕鬆找到它這裡.
  3. IDE 設定:確保您有一個整合開發環境 (IDE),例如為 .NET 開發設定的 Visual Studio。
  4. 範例 SXC 檔案:在本教學中,我們將使用範例 SXC 檔案。下載一個或建立您自己的一個以進行後續操作。 一旦一切準備就緒,您就可以繼續前進了!

導入包

首先,我們需要在 C# 檔案中匯入必要的套件。這是至關重要的,因為它允許我們使用 Aspose.Cells 提供的功能。您通常需要以下內容:

using System.IO;
using Aspose.Cells;
using System;

現在,您已經設定了可以輕鬆處理 Excel 檔案的軟體套件。讓我們分解程式碼並逐步完成開啟和讀取 SXC 檔案所需的步驟。

第 1 步:設定您的項目

首先,我們需要在 Visual Studio 中為我們的應用程式建立一個新專案。請依照下列步驟操作:

  1. 開啟 Visual Studio 並選擇「建立新專案」。
  2. 根據您的喜好選擇 ASP.NET Core Web 應用程式或控制台應用程式。
  3. 為您的專案命名(類似SXCFileOpener)並點擊創建。
  4. 確保在此設定過程中選擇了 .NET 框架。
  5. 項目加載後,您將看到預設的.cs我們可以在其中新增程式碼的檔案。

步驟2:新增Aspose.Cells庫

接下來,我們將 Aspose.Cells 庫新增到我們的專案中。方法如下:

  1. 在解決方案資源管理器中右鍵單擊您的專案並選擇“管理 NuGet 套件”,開啟 NuGet 套件管理器。
  2. 切換到瀏覽選項卡並蒐索Aspose.Cells.
  3. 按一下搜尋結果中 Aspose.Cells 套件旁的安裝。
  4. 如果出現提示,請接受任何許可或協議。 成功安裝 Aspose.Cells 後,我們現在就可以寫程式了!

第三步:設定來源目錄

現在,我們需要建立一個來源目錄,從中載入 SXC 檔案。方法如下:

  1. 在程式檔案的頂部,定義來源目錄:
string sourceDir = "Your Document Directory";
  1. 在此目錄中,新增您的 SXC 範例檔案(例如,SampleSXC.sxc)進行測試。

第 4 步:建立工作簿對象

設定了來源目錄後,是時候建立一個Workbook物件載入我們的 SXC 檔案:

Workbook workbook = new Workbook(sourceDir + "SampleSXC.sxc");

該行初始化一個新的Workbook使用指定的路徑。這類似於打開一本書 - 您現在可以翻閱它的頁面(工作表)!

第 5 步:訪問工作表

接下來,我們將訪問工作簿中的第一個工作表:

Worksheet worksheet = workbook.Worksheets[0];

將工作表視為書中的不同章節 - 在這裡,我們選擇第一章。

步驟 6:造訪特定小區

現在,讓我們存取一個特定的單元格,比如說C3,並讀取其值:

Cell cell = worksheet.Cells["C3"];

在此步驟中,您將精確定位資訊的確切位置,就像在索引中尋找特定條目一樣。

步驟7:顯示儲存格訊息

最後,我們將單元格的名稱及其值列印到控制台:

Console.WriteLine("Cell Name: " + cell.Name + " Value: " + cell.StringValue);
Console.WriteLine("OpeningSXCFiles executed successfully!");

這就是魔法發生的地方!這就像揭開隱藏在書中的寶藏一樣。您將在控制台中看到顯示儲存格 C3 的名稱和值的輸出。

結論

就是這樣!您已使用 Aspose.Cells for .NET 成功開啟了 SXC 檔案並存取了特定儲存格的資料。此過程使處理 Excel 和類似文件變得簡單,使您能夠在應用程式中讀取、寫入和操作此類文件。 Aspose.Cells 真正讓使用電子表格變得輕而易舉,讓您能夠專注於構建強大的應用程序,而不會陷入複雜的文件處理困境。

常見問題解答

什麼是 .SXC 檔案?

SXC 文件是由 StarOffice Calc 或 OpenOffice.org Calc 創建的電子表格文件,類似於 Excel 文件,但專為不同的軟體而設計。

我可以使用 Aspose.Cells 將 SXC 檔案轉換為其他格式嗎?

絕對地! Aspose.Cells 支援轉換為各種格式,如 XLSX、CSV 和 PDF。

我需要 Aspose.Cells 許可證嗎?

Aspose.Cells 是一款高級產品,雖然可以免費試用,但需要授權才能繼續使用。您可以獲得臨時許可證這裡.

是否可以使用 Aspose.Cells 編輯 SXC 檔案?

是的!將 SXC 檔案載入到 Workbook 物件後,您可以輕鬆地操作其儲存格內的資料。

在哪裡可以找到有關 Aspose.Cells 的更多資訊?

如需更多詳細資訊和進階功能,請參閱文件.